Understanding Safety Protocols for Traffic Operations

What Are Safety Protocols?

Safety protocols are established guidelines and procedures aimed at preventing accidents and ensuring safe practices during traffic operations. These protocols are crucial in environments where vehicles and pedestrians share space, such as construction zones, busy intersections, and road maintenance areas.

Key Safety Protocols for Traffic Operations

1. Traffic Control Devices

Traffic control devices, including signs, signals, and barriers, play a vital role in guiding vehicles safely through construction zones. Proper placement and maintenance of these devices are essential for effective safety protocols.

Benefits of Traffic Control Devices

  • Clear Communication: Indicate road conditions and provide warnings to drivers.
  • Guidance: Help direct traffic to alternate routes if necessary.
  • Prevention: Minimize the chances of collisions with clear markings and signals.

2. Personnel Training

Training personnel in traffic safety protocols is critical for successful operations. This includes:

  • Flagging techniques
  • Emergency response procedures
  • Communication skills with drivers and pedestrians

Regular training programs ensure that all personnel are equipped to handle various traffic scenarios safely. For more information, refer to our detailed guide on traffic compliance training programs.

3. Use of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

PPE is an essential aspect of safety protocols. Workers should always wear high-visibility clothing, hard hats, and other protective gear to prevent accidents. This is particularly important in scenarios where workers are in close proximity to moving vehicles.

4. Regular Safety Audits

Conducting regular safety audits helps identify potential hazards and areas for improvement. These audits should assess:

  • Traffic patterns
  • Compliance with safety protocols
  • Equipment effectiveness

By addressing identified issues promptly, traffic operations can remain safe and effective.

5. Emergency Response Planning

Preparing for emergencies is a crucial safety protocol. Having a clear response plan for incidents like accidents or equipment failures ensures that traffic personnel can act quickly and effectively, minimizing injury and disruption. Key elements of an emergency response plan include:

  • Designated emergency contacts
  • Clear communication channels
  • Regular drills to practice response procedures

Communicating with the Public

Importance of Public Awareness

Public awareness is vital in traffic operations. Informing the community about ongoing traffic control measures enhances safety. Effective communication can be achieved through:

  • Signage to inform motorists of construction
  • Social media updates on traffic conditions
  • Outreach programs to educate the public

Community Engagement Tactics

Engaging the community fosters cooperation and understanding. Consider using:

  • Public meetings to discuss construction plans
  • Informational flyers distributed to local businesses
  • Collaboration with local media to broadcast traffic updates
